    I'm gonna plump for Blur for the simple fact that outside of Leisure and Great Escape I think all of their albums are classics, with particular nods to Blur and Modern Life. It'll be interesting to hear the new material they're recording at the moment, new album is due for a May release I think. Damon also has a solo project based on his Democrazy EP coming our this year and some more Mali Musicesque material to be released aswell, should be a busy year for Mr.Albarn alright
